In-Text 4. Death and Hades, (that is the place or world of the dead, or the kingdome and power of death ) were cast into Hell. It were absurde to saye, Death and Hell were cast into Hell: and therefore so we saye also in the verse before, Death and the World of the Dead, rendred vp their dead to iudgment. 4.
